Chelsea boss Carlo Ancelotti has played down claims he has his team playing the best football seen at the club in years.
The Italian has been praised for making once-pragmatic Chelsea attractive as well as powerful this season.
"I don't think we are more exciting," said the manager, who preferred Chelsea's penalty at Bolton last weekend to the intricate fourth goal created by Frank Lampard and Deco for Didier Drogba.
"The last goal I wasn't excited about. I was excited about the first goal, the goal which gives us the possibility to win. It was a fantastic action for Drogba's goal, but I'm not excited by this."
